1990 Eastern League season

From Wikipedia, the free encyclopedia

The 1990 Eastern League season began on approximately April 1 and the regular season ended on approximately September 1.

The London Tigers defeated the New Britain Red Sox three games to zero to win the Eastern League Championship Series.
